Bryan City Council holds second reading on proposed sewer-rate changes
Summary
At its Feb. 2 meeting, the Bryan City Council conducted a second reading of Ordinance 4-2026, which would revise residential, commercial and industrial sewer rates inside and outside the city. Staff presented comparative rate figures for neighboring towns and said Bryan’s proposed rates remain comparatively low.
Bryan City Council held a second reading Feb. 2 for Ordinance 4-2026, which proposes changes to residential, commercial and industrial sewer rates both inside and outside the city and includes an emergency clause.
